High Frequency 18-26.5GHz Coaxial RF Circulator Manufacturer ACT18G26.5G14S

Description:

● Frequency range: supports 18-26.5GHz frequency band.

● Features: low insertion loss, high isolation, high return loss, supports 10W power output, and adapts to wide temperature working environment.


Product Parameter

Product Detail

Parameter Specification
Frequency range 18-26.5GHz
Insertion loss P1→ P2→ P3: 1.6dB max
Isolation P3→ P2→ P1: 14dB min
Return Loss 12 dB min
Forward Power 10W
Direction clockwise
Operating Temperature -30 ºC to +70ºC

  • Product Description

    ACT18G26.5G14S is a high- frequency coaxial RF circulator designed for the 18–26.5GHz high frequency band. It is widely used in K-Band wireless communication, Test Instrumentation, 5G base station systems and microwave RF equipment. Its low insertion loss, high isolation and high return loss ensure efficient and stable signal transmission, reduce system interference and improve system performance.

    The K-Band coaxial circulator supports 10W power output, adapts to the working environment of -30°C to +70°C, and is suitable for a variety of complex working conditions. The product adopts a 2.92mm coaxial interface (female). The structure complies with RoHS environmental protection standards and supports green and sustainable development.
